Summary
The unicode character "狼" at code point U+F92B is a CJK (Chinese Japanese Korean) ideogram meaning "wolf". It is a character in the CJK Compatibility Ideographs block and is part of the Han script. The character is an other letter. The UTF-8 encoding of "狼" is 0xEF 0xA4 0xAB and the UTF-16 encoding is 0xF92B.
